We are seeking a compassionate and dedicated Support Worker to join our team. The ideal candidate will play a vital role in providing active support to individuals at our day centre, and in the community. This position requires a patient and empathetic individual who has experience working with individuals who have complex needs.
Duties
Assist service users to access and engage in our services/activities
Provide companionship and emotional support to service users, fostering a positive and encouraging environment.
Support individuals with mobility challenges.
Encourage service users participation in community events.
Maintain accurate records of care provided and report any concerns to the appropriate healthcare professionals.
Collaborate with other staff to prioritise the safety and wellbeing of all service users.
Requirements
Previous experience working with individuals who have complex needs or behaviour that can be challenging.
Knowledge of learning disabilities, autism and acquired brain injury
Strong communication skills and the ability to build rapport with service users and their families.
A caring and patient attitude with a genuine desire to help others improve their quality of life.
Physical capability to assist with mobility support when needed.
Relevant qualifications or certifications in health and social care are beneficial
